Actors and actresses at the Oscars always say they are unprepared when their name gets called and they clamber on stage to accept the glory, yet somehow they piece together an eloquent and heartfelt tribute. Good work and so ‘off the cuff’ you guys.
My favourite part, though, remains when the camera shows the other nominees pretending to play it cool and look happy for the winner. Yeah, they are delighted you won and not them, naturally.
Cue Michael Keaton, nominated in the Best Actor category for his role in Birdman, who was so sure he would win he was actually holding his Oscar speech in his hand. Alas, the award went to The Theory of Everything actor Eddie Redmayne.
I believe the word the kids of today are using is ‘awkwies’.
